A key fob allows you to lock and unlock your car without using traditional keys. It transmits radio signals to the vehicle, which activate the locking systems on board and ignition. The signal also enables the car to scan the ID of the key fob, so it knows whether or not you are close enough to open and operate the doors and trunk.

The method of programming these systems may differ based on the model of vehicle and the manufacturer. Certain manufacturers employ a radio-frequency (RF) method for reprogramming, while others require special equipment to access the internal memory of the system. It's important to follow the steps carefully in order to avoid a mistake or doing it incorrectly can cause the failure to program the new fob.

How do you program a Fob for a Key Fob

To program a keyfob you must first make sure you have the correct key. Blank key fobs can be purchased on the internet or at a variety of dealerships. They must be made specifically for the make and the model of the car to which they will be attached. This information is available on the key fobs themselves or by looking up the vehicle's VIN.

After you have the right key, follow these steps to enter programming mode: Get into your vehicle from the driver's side and shut all doors, except for the driver's door. Insert and remove the ignition key several times until the hazard lights flash. This means that you are in the programming keys mode and your vehicle is now ready to accept an additional fob. Repeat the process for each of the new fobs you want to program.

How do you program a keyless entry remote?

Car key fobs are handy and practical, but they can also be a headache if they are not working properly. If they are acting up the first thing you need to try is replacing the battery. If this doesn't fix the problem, you may need to take your car to an expert.

While the process varies depending on the make and model of the vehicle, it is possible to program your own key fobs at home without having to visit a dealer for assistance. However, it is important to remember that not all cars allow self-programming. You will need to read the owner's manual or look up your vehicle on the internet for more detailed instructions.

First, you'll need to gather all of the fobs that you wish to program and keep them nearby. Most vehicles erase all previously programmed fobs during the program process, which is why it is essential to ensure that they are in the vicinity prior to starting. You will then need to enter your vehicle and close all the doors. Press and hold the lock button on one of your new key fobs for several seconds. You will then need to wait for your car to respond to the request, typically by either cycling the locks or chiming. When you hear the locks cycle or a sound, you can begin to program the additional fobs.

Repeat the process for each fob you want to program, ensuring that you do it within the specified time frame of the vehicle. After you've completed the program check the fobs to make sure they function as intended. If the fobs do not work properly, you may need to repeat the procedure or seek out an expert.
